PCB Calls Back Zaman, Khan, Rauf & Hasnain From BBL To Prepare For PSL
The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) on Sunday has recalled left-handed batter Fakhar Zaman, leg-spin all-rounder Shadab Khan and pacers Haris Rauf and Mohammad Hasnain to return from the ongoing Big Bash League (BBL) in order to prepare for the upcoming season of the Pakistan Super League (PSL) starting from January 27.
Zaman had arrived in the tournament to replace an injured England batter Tom Abell for Brisbane Heat. Due to the Covid-19 restrictions and travel issues in the states of Australia, Zaman was able to play just one match for the club.
